Journey of love of history
Chi began her love for History very naturally, since she was a middle school student. Chi's family had a special habit. On holidays, the whole family would often travel to famous historical sites instead of entertainment venues. From these trips, the sacredness of historical sites, the antiquity of ancient capitals, the significance of citadel walls... entered Chi's subconscious, bringing with them many feelings of pride and excitement.

At each destination, in addition to listening to the explanations, Chi also collected books to better understand the events and characters. The more she learned, the more her love for History and national pride grew. The heroic battles and glorious achievements of her ancestors always moved her when she learned about them. During her final years of secondary school, while many young people were indifferent to History, Khanh Chi had a concern that was "older" than her age: How to help more people understand and be proud of Vietnamese history?
This was also the motivation for Chi to win the provincial excellent student award in both Literature and History in 9th grade and become a student in the History specialized class in 10th grade.Phan Boi Chau High School for the Gifted.

One of the most difficult aspects of History is memorizing data. Under the guidance of her teachers, Chi learned how to find keywords and the essence of events before memorizing details. This effective way of learning, along with her intelligence and diligence, helped Chi win the Second Prize of the National Excellent Student in grade 11.
Ms. Le Thi Phuong - Chi's homeroom teacher, who is also the head of the National Excellent Student History Team of Nghe An province in the 2020-2021 school year, commented: "Chi is an intelligent girl, talented, self-studying, very good at discovering and analyzing problems. Chi's assignments always demonstrate the ability to generalize, apply knowledge flexibly, creatively and rich in historical emotions. This is also the strength that helps Chi score points in major competitions."
The “worthy” things
Not only is Khanh Chi an excellent and hard-working student, she is also a good daughter and a responsible sister. Khanh Chi's mother unfortunately had an accident, breaking both her arms right when she was preparing for the National Excellent Student exam. So every day, in addition to going to school twice a day, Chi takes care of the housework and the two younger siblings, thoughtfully and carefully.
Chi's house is 15 km from school, so she has to travel the farthest in the team. There were days when it rained heavily, the flood water caused the electric bike to break down, and Chi had to walk home. There were days when she studied until late at night, and she had to ask her family to pick her up. Many times when she failed her test, Chi doubted her own abilities and thought about giving up... But Chi didn't do that. She had a reason to try her best.

“This year’s National Excellent Student History Team includes Khanh Chi and two other students who were members of last year’s National Excellent Student Team. All three students do not intend to take part in this year’s National Excellent Student Exam but want to focus on the university entrance exam. That way, they will be less tired and have less risk. However, when they heard me say that this exam is not just for them anymore, it is also the hope and glory of the school, the province... all three accepted the challenge and were determined to take the exam. The whole team has tried their best for their homeland Nghe An” - Ms. Le Thi Phuong was moved when talking about her students.
Putting aside the difficulties, Chi and her friends encouraged each other to try harder. It was sad and discouraging, but then they did the exercises together.

On the day the exam results were announced, all the team members were both excited and worried. Chi received the news that she had won first prize while on her way home from school. The phone call had just ended when Chi’s joy burst into tears. The History major cried the rest of the way home and continued to cry for a long time after that, when she shared with her parents.
The achievements of Chi in particular and of the whole team in general are the “sweet fruit” of the passion for History and the love for the homeland and country. Or as Chi said: “We have worthy reasons to strive and our efforts have been duly rewarded”.
This year, Nghe An had 102 candidates participating in the National Excellent Student Competition, of which 81 students won prizes, with 7 First prizes, 25 Second prizes, 27 Third prizes and 22 Encouragement prizes. Of the 7 First prizes achieved this year, there was 1 First prize in Mathematics, 1 First prize in Information Technology, 1 First prize in Physics, 1 First prize in History, 1 First prize in Literature and 2 First prizes in Biology.
In history alone, in addition to 1 first prize, there are 3 second prizes, 4 third prizes and 2 consolation prizes.
